Revelstoke Museum and Archives is pleased to be hosting "BC's Marvellous Mushrooms," a travelling exhibit from the Royal BC Museum in Victoria. The exhibit explores the science and practical uses of mushrooms, highlighting some of the most fascinating of the 3,400 known species in the province. Meet award-winning author Ellen Schwartz at Otter Books and get a signed copy of her new book, “Galena Bay Odyssey: Reflections of a Hippie Homesteader” (Heritage House, 2023). In her memoir, Ellen reflects on the idealistic, tumultuous, and eye-opening time she spent as a back-to-the-land hippie homesteader in Kootenays in the 1970s. https://www.heritagehouse.ca/book/galena-bay-odyssey/
